First Medicare is composed of two basic parts; Part An and Part B. Medicare part An includes all hospital expenses, including hospital stays and any other expense and that be incurred inside a hospital. Medicare Part B covers any expenses that occur in a physician ‘s office ; such as MRIs, Ct Scans, Etc, outpatient surgeries. Together B & Medicare part A makeup original Medicare.
Medicare will not cover 100% of your medical bills. As folks get mature health problems can appear and more medical bills can be incurred. With no Medigap or Medicare Supplement Plan and only Medicare you are able to face a big bill that is 20% of the total invoice. 20% of a very big statement is still an extremely large bill. This is why many folks choose to get a Medicare Supplement Plan to help shield them against the high price that can happen from other medical expense or a hospital stay.
Summary Of Medigap Policies
There are 10 standardized Medigap insurance plans to choose from. These plans are regulated by the US government Medicare and are designed to work with Initial Medicare to pay for what Original Medicare doesn’t cover in full (the 20% that’s left over). Medicare supplement plans are identified by a insurance plan letter A-N. Because the plans are standardized and regulated, the benefits are precisely the same no matter what business is offering the plan. The only difference between an identical Medigap insurance plan letter with companies that are distinct is the price. Medigap Plan F
Medicare Supplement Plan F is one of the very popular addition insurance plans. This plan covers 100% of all that is left over by Original Medicare. For instance, F covers the Part A deductible, all hospital bills, and something that happens in every other medical facility at 100% or a doctor ‘s office. This really is the only Medicare Supplement Plan that offers 100% complete comprehensive coverage.
Medigap Insurance Plan G
Medicare Supplement Plan G is a insurance plan we like to advocate the most and often referred to as the Gold Plan. It’s virtually identical to Plan F. The only difference is a yearly deductible of $166 for the year on Plan G. Other than that the benefits are just the same as Plan F. Medigap Plan N
Medicare Supplement Plan N is the third most popular alternative and it’s in regards to some of the other Medicare supplement plans similar.. .. Unless you are admitted plan N does have a $50 copay at the ER, an office copay of 0 Part B deductible of $166, and Part B excess charges usually are not covered.. .. This plan is good for individuals who would like to appreciate a lower premium have nearly total coverage at other high medical bills and the hospital that can occur.

When Is The Best Time To Buy A Medicare Supplement Plan?
The best time to purchase Medicare Supplement Plan is when you are first eligible for Medicare; during your open enrollment for Medigap. During this time which starts six months before your 65th birthday and last for six months after your 65th birthday you can join a Medicare Supplement Plan regardless of your health. There aren’t any questions for pre-existing conditions and it is possible to get any Medigap plan you want from any carrier
If you should be looking to change plans or get a plan for the very first time and past the age of 65 you may need to answer some essential health questions to qualify. Most folks and qualify so you should still be able to get a insurance plan.
